Dan Wack - 'Finite Moments'
Trying to encapsulate the experience of exploring different local areas, as the world slowly goes back to normal and finds its pulse and heartbeat. The location recordings featured in this EP are all recorded in an effort to capture a specific atmosphere that contains different aspects of the natural world. During the production of this collection of tracks, creativity was scarce and fleeting moments allowed Dan to realise that the textural elements of each track gave direction and focus. Dan Wack & Oliver Ryles - 'Sequence Recurring'
'Sequence Recurring' is an exploration into how our brains operate in different stages of sleep. Each piece incorporates research into its design - brain waves converted in to Hz; each composition's length is proportionate to the length of each stage of sleep. |
Dan Wack - 'Stalking The Horizon'
Dan uses real life concepts and elements; giving them a musical context, creating unique stories and worlds for the listener to delve into. He creates harmony through stretching the creative possibilities of acoustic and electronic instruments. Dan creates ideas throughout everyday life - taking inspiration from the details that are often overlooked. 'Stalking The Horizon is an experimentation into the Ocean’s tidal rhythm, and its sheer beauty - whilst also integrating my experiences and its impact on my life. This concept is brought to life by experimenting with reverb tails, subtle harmonic layering and creative use of location recordings' Released on: Assembly Field |
